This is a little thing that still really annoys me about using Bitiwg. You can work around it by going into full screen mode (OSX), however I usually forget to do that or don't want to or because I want to use the finder with bitwig or something.

I just find I constantly have to close a plug-in window that I otherwise wouldn't have, just to see another application for a second.

Post

Sent a mail about this to support a while ago, got this response:
...is a result of the plugin sandboxing.
We hope to find a way to get around this, but basically they run like standalone applications and are no child windows of Bitwig Studio.
